Discovering the Allure of Solome by Titian: A Masterpiece of the Venetian Renaissance
The Historical Context of Solome: Unveiling the 16th Century
The Venetian Renaissance: A Flourishing Era of Art and Culture
The 16th century marked a vibrant period known as the Venetian Renaissance. This era was characterized by a surge in artistic innovation, where painters like Titian transformed the landscape of art. Venice became a hub for creativity, blending influences from the East and West. The city's unique canals and architecture inspired artists to explore new themes and techniques, making it a cradle for masterpieces.Influences on Titian: The Impact of Mythology and Religion
Titian drew inspiration from both mythology and religious narratives. His works often reflect the rich tapestry of Venetian life, where classical themes intertwined with Christian stories. The story of Salome, a figure from the Bible, captivated Titian, allowing him to explore themes of power, seduction, and morality. This blend of influences helped shape the dramatic storytelling seen in "Solome."Analyzing the Artistic Techniques in Solome: Brushstrokes and Color Palette
Chiaroscuro: The Play of Light and Shadow in Titian's Work
Titian masterfully employed chiaroscuro, a technique that contrasts light and dark to create depth. In "Solome," the interplay of shadows enhances the emotional intensity of the scene. The dramatic lighting draws the viewer's eye to Salome, emphasizing her role in the narrative. This technique not only adds dimension but also evokes a sense of drama and tension.Color Symbolism: Understanding the Palette Choices in Solome
The color palette in "Solome" is rich and evocative. Titian used deep reds and golds to symbolize passion and power. The vibrant hues of Salome's attire contrast with the somber tones of the background, highlighting her significance. Each color choice serves a purpose, enhancing the emotional weight of the painting and inviting viewers to delve deeper into its meaning.Thematic Exploration: The Story Behind Solome and Her Dance
Historical Figures: Who Was Solome in Biblical Narratives?
Salome is a compelling figure in biblical history, known for her dance that led to the beheading of John the Baptist. Her story is one of seduction and manipulation, showcasing the complexities of female power in a patriarchal society. Titian's portrayal captures her allure and the dark consequences of her actions, inviting viewers to reflect on the themes of desire and consequence.The Dance of Death: Symbolism and Interpretation in Art
The dance of Salome is often interpreted as a dance of death. In "Solome," this theme resonates through the tension between beauty and horror. The act of dancing becomes a metaphor for the fleeting nature of life and the inevitable approach of death. Titian's depiction encourages viewers to ponder the moral implications of Salome's choices and the price of ambition.Iconography in Solome: Decoding the Visual Elements

What is the story behind the painting Solome by Titian?
"Solome" depicts the biblical story of Salome, who dances for King Herod and requests the head of John the Baptist as a reward. This narrative explores themes of seduction, power, and moral consequence.How does Solome reflect the themes of power and seduction?
The painting captures Salome's allure and the dark consequences of her actions, showcasing the complexities of female power in a patriarchal society.What techniques did Titian use to create depth in Solome?
Titian used chiaroscuro to create depth, contrasting light and shadow to enhance the emotional intensity of the scene.Where can I see the original Solome painting today?
The original "Solome" painting is housed in the Museo del Prado in Madrid, Spain, where visitors can appreciate its grandeur.What are the key elements of the composition in Solome?
Key elements include Salome's dramatic pose, the stark contrast of colors, and the haunting presence of John the Baptist's head, all contributing to the painting's emotional impact.How does Solome compare to other works of the Venetian Renaissance?
"Solome" exemplifies the Venetian Renaissance's focus on color, emotion, and narrative depth, placing it alongside other masterpieces that explore similar themes.FAQs About Solome Painting Reproductions
